Use case 4: Edge RSTP - AS-1 is connected to AS-2 via IB-tagged endpoint and
both the AS on ES facing side with different S-VLAN

The following deployment scenario is a case where RSTP is deployed on a VPLS instance which has
a S-VLAN configured to the ES facing side and B-VLAN configured which connects 2 ASs.

AS-1 is configured as a ROOT Bridge. VPLS VLAN 200 is configured in AS-1 and AS-2 acts as B-VLAN
which connects AS-1 and AS-2. VPLS VLAN 300 is configured in AS-1 connects AS-1 to ES-1 and
VPLS VLSN 500 on AS-2 connects AS-2 to ES-1. In AS-1 VPLS VLAN 200 and 300 are configured
under same VPLS instance and AS-2 VPLS VLAN 200 and 500 are configured under the same VPLS
Instance. VPLS VLAN 300 (S-VLAN) configured on ES-1 which connects to AS-1 and VPLS VLAN 500
connects to AS-2.

The following discussion describes how to configure the nodes in the topology.

Configuring AS-1
Tag type configuration

Configure the port tag type for B-VLAN to 0x88a8.

Brocade_AS-1(config)#tag-type 88e8 eth 1/1

Configure port tag type for S-VLAN to 0x9100.

Brocade_AS-1(config)#tag-type 9100 eth 1/2

B-VLAN Configuration

Brocade_AS-1(config)#vlan 200

Brocade_AS-1(config-vlan-200)#tagged ethernet 1/1

Brocade_AS-1(config)#router mpls

Brocade_AS-1(config-mpls)#vpls pbb-vlan 1
